annotate benchmark/find.js @ 0:44465893e8b8

first Commit
author Kazuma
date Wed, 30 Nov 2016 01:47:55 +0900
parents
children
Ignore whitespace changes - Everywhere: Within whitespace: At end of lines:
rev   line source
0
44465893e8b8 first Commit
Kazuma
parents:
diff changeset
1 function findDataLoop () {
44465893e8b8 first Commit
Kazuma
parents:
diff changeset
2 var date_obj = new Date();
44465893e8b8 first Commit
Kazuma
parents:
diff changeset
3 var milliseconds = date_obj.getTime();
44465893e8b8 first Commit
Kazuma
parents:
diff changeset
4 for (var i = 1; i<= 50000; i++) {
44465893e8b8 first Commit
Kazuma
parents:
diff changeset
5 var personData = db.person1.find({PersonId:"p:9"}).next();
44465893e8b8 first Commit
Kazuma
parents:
diff changeset
6 var roleId = personData.roleId
44465893e8b8 first Commit
Kazuma
parents:
diff changeset
7 }
44465893e8b8 first Commit
Kazuma
parents:
diff changeset
8 date_obj = new Date();
44465893e8b8 first Commit
Kazuma
parents:
diff changeset
9 print(date_obj.getTime() - milliseconds)
44465893e8b8 first Commit
Kazuma
parents:
diff changeset
10 }
44465893e8b8 first Commit
Kazuma
parents:
diff changeset
11
44465893e8b8 first Commit
Kazuma
parents:
diff changeset
12 function findData () {
44465893e8b8 first Commit
Kazuma
parents:
diff changeset
13 var personVer = db.config.find({configVer:"v:1"}).next().PersonVer;
44465893e8b8 first Commit
Kazuma
parents:
diff changeset
14 var personCollection = db.getCollection(personVer);
44465893e8b8 first Commit
Kazuma
parents:
diff changeset
15 db.person1.find({PersonId:"p:9"}).next();
44465893e8b8 first Commit
Kazuma
parents:
diff changeset
16 }